What is an Accident Injury Lawsuit?
An accident injury lawsuit is a legal claim filed by a specific (the plaintiff) who has suffered injuries due to the neglect or wrongful act of another party (the accused). The primary objective of such claims is to obtain compensation for damages sustained, which may consist of medical expenditures, lost earnings, pain and suffering, and other losses.

Q1: How long do I have to submit a lawsuit after an accident?

A: The time limitation to submit a lawsuit varies by state due to statutes of restrictions. Normally, it varies from one to 3 years from the date of the accident. It is recommended to seek advice from a lawyer quickly.

Q2: What should I do immediately after an accident?

A: Seek medical attention, record the accident scene, collect witness info, and contact a lawyer before consulting with insurance representatives.

Q3: How is compensation determined in an injury lawsuit?

A: Compensation is calculated based upon factors such as med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and the degree of carelessness demonstrated by the defendant.

Q4: Will my case go to trial?

A: Most accident cases are settled before reaching trial. Nevertheless, if a fair settlement can not be reached, the case may continue to court.

Q5: How much will a lawyer cost?

A: Many accident injury legal representatives work on a contingency fee basis, implying they only get payment if you win your case. Their charges typically range from 25% to 40% of the granted compensation.
